Louise Gustafsson is a scholar working on Rehabilitation, Psychiatry and Mental health and Occupational Therapy. According to data from OpenAlex, Louise Gustafsson has authored 168 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 71 papers in Rehabilitation, 50 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health and 37 papers in Occupational Therapy. Recurrent topics in Louise Gustafsson’s work include Stroke Rehabilitation and Recovery (66 papers),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(35 papers) and Occupational Therapy Practice and Research (32 papers). Louise Gustafsson is often cited by papers focused on Stroke Rehabilitation and Recovery (66 papers),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(35 papers) and Occupational Therapy Practice and Research (32 papers). Louise Gustafsson coll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United States and The Netherlands. Louise Gustafsson's co-authors include Jacki Liddle, Kryss McKenna, Ted Brown, Carol McKinstry, Tammy Aplin, Nancy A. Pachana, Desleigh de Jonge, Peter A. Silburn, Jennifer Fleming and Sally Bennett and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Environmental Psychology, Accident Analysis & Prevention and The Gerontologist.
